Discovery Phase
Perform Preliminary Analysis of Facility to Confirm Viability of Facility Analysis and Product Installation
Site assessment including:
- Logistics
- Location of motors
- Facility Access
Utility of 600 volts or less
Choose random sample motors to verify current operating conditions to include:
- Proper rotation
- Temperature
- Voltage, Amperage
- KW
- KVA
- Power Factor
- KVAR
- Horse Power
Monitor Main Utiility
Phase II - Facility Assessment
Verify Condition of Incoming Utility>
- Utility of 600 volts or less
- Capacitors current operating condition (if applicable)
- Surge Protection operating condition (if applicable)
Verify Operating Conditions of Inductive Loads at Component Level
Detailed data logging and analysis of all inductive loads within the facility including:
- Chillers
- Pumps
- Air Handler Units
- Fans
- Boiler motors
Insure proper rotation of motors
Measure temperature of motors
Develop a detailed reading of all inductive loads as listed above to include:
- Motor Nomenclature, Voltage, Amperage
- KW
- KVA
- Power Factor
- KVAR
- Horse Power
